    Notes: Abstract. In the Rhine-Delta, accumulation of microcontaminants in floodplain foodwebs has received little attention in comparison with aquatic communities. Here, soil and cattle milk samples were taken from three floodplains and analyzed for pol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s), dibenzodioxins (PCDDs) and dibenzofurans (PCDFs). Based on 2,3,7,8-tetrachlorodibenzodioxin equivalents, total PCDD and PCDF residues in milk did not exceed the quality standard of 0.006 μg/kg fat weight. This was still the case if non- and mono-ortho PCBs were added to the total. Yet, the floodplains investigated were only moderately polluted according to previous studies and one cannot exclude higher levels in milk from other floodplains. Bioconcentration ratios of milk fat vs soil organic matter were about 0.01 to 0.1 for persistent PCBs. These values are in accordance with a few literature data found for other persistent compounds. Yet, ratios are lower than expected from equilibrium partitioning. Ratios for PCDDs and PCDFs were even lower, possibly due to biotransformation.

    Notes: Summary In 22 endocrinologically active hypophyseal adenomas the relationship between the biological behaviour and the cytological picture was investigated. There was a positive correlation between the atypia of the cells in the cytograms and hormone secretion of the tumour cells in vitro and the clinical aggressiveness. Cytological examination gave a better insight into the biological properties of these tumours than histological methods.

    Notes: Summary Neuron-specific enolase (NSE) was measured in serum samples of 35 patients with small cell lung cancer and 10 control patients. The samples were collected during 10 days after the first course of chemotherapy, in order to investigate whether changes of NSE had a predictive value for tumour response. Three patterns of change of NSE were observed. Pattern 1 showed an increase of serum NSE with a maximum value more than 1.5 times the pretreatment level (n=17); pattern 2 involved no increase at all or less than 1.5 times the pretreatment level (n=14); pattern 3 showed a continuous decrease (n=5). No relationship between the three patterns of change and the tumour response was observed. Only an NSE level 〈10 ng/ml at the time of start of the second course predicted a major response.

    Notes: Summary Serum samples were collected from 115 small-cell lung cancer patients before each course of chemotherapy and during follow-up. Levels of neuronspecific enolase (NSE) were measured and compared to the clinical assessments of the course of the disease, which were done by the responsible physician without knowledge of NSE-values. The predictive accuracy of an increase or decrease of NSE for a major response (CR+PR), SD or PD was 98%. Importantly no falsepositive rises of NSE were observed. On the basis of this large number of data it seems justified to conclude that in common clinical practice the treatment of small-cell lung cancer patients can be monitored by serial measurements of NSE alone.

    Notes: Summary Serum acid phosphatase activity is known to be elevated in a number of patients with metastatic prostatic carcinoma. Prostatic acid phosphatase (PAP) can be specifically measured by immunological methods. In this study we evaluated an enzyme-immunoassay of the sandwich type utilizing monoclonal antibodies. Immunoassayable PAP decreased after storage at room temperature for 72 h and also after repeated freezing and thawing, although not evident in all samples. PAP levels were measured in 88 newly diagnosed prostatic carcinoma patients, in 124 patients with histologically proven benign prostatic hypertrophy (BPH) and in 124 elderly hospitalized male patients without urological complaints. The upper limit of normal, as determined in the control group, was 2.3 μg/l. Of the BPH patients, 17% had elevated PAP levels (range 2.4–27 μg/l). We found a positive correlation between prostate volume (grams of tissue removed during TUR) and preoperative PAP values (r=0.26, N=121, P〈0.01). Elevated PAP levels were found in 3% of BPH patients with a prostate volume of less than 20 g (N=63), in contrast with 55% of patients with a prostate volume above 50 g (N=18). The sensitivity of this PAP assay for detecting the clinical stages of prostatic carcinoma was 13% for category To (N=15), 30% for category T1–2 (N=20), 71% for category T3–4 (N=24), and 83% for category M1 or N1–4 (N=29). The upper limit of normal (2.3 μg/l) as calculated from a large group of controls with a mean age of 62 years is rather similar to the value found in younger controls. In BPH patients, however, elevated PAP levels may be found which are seen more frequently in patients with a large prostate. Thus, for the calculation of the normal range, it is not recommended to include the results from BPH patients. The sensitivity of this enzyme-immunoassay with monoclonal antibodies in detecting prostatic cancer, at a specificity of 98%, is comparable to other immunoassays for PAP.

    Notes: Summary Changes in the number of autofluorescent and serotonin-containing pinealocytes have been studied after gonadotropic hormone administration using fluorescence histochemistry. Moreover, the 5-HT levels in the pineal gland were determined biochemically under the same experimental conditions. The results suggest that pineal 5-HT levels are not influenced by increased gonadotropin levels, while the amount of autofluorescent pinealocytes increases after gonadotropin injections. It has been postulated that differences in androgenic hormone levels could not cause the changes in the number of autofluorescent pinealocytes. The reaction of the pineal gland to increased gonadotropin levels seemed important in view of the regulatory function of the epiphysis on the hypothalamo-hypophyseo-gonadal axis.
